Network Security Engineer - Cache Valley Electric
Security Engineer
Design, implement, and manage secure network infrastructures, focusing on firewalls, VPNs, and intrusion detection systems while automating tasks with Python and supporting enterprise Cisco environments.
About the role
Key Responsibilities
- Design and deploy secure network architectures, including firewalls, VPNs, and IDS/IPS solutions, to protect client and internal systems.
- Configure, monitor, and troubleshoot Cisco routing and switching equipment to ensure optimal performance and security compliance.
- Develop and maintain automation scripts (Python) for routine security tasks, policy updates, and incident response.
- Conduct vulnerability assessments, risk analyses, and security audits, providing actionable recommendations to stakeholders.
- Collaborate with cross‑functional teams to integrate security controls into cloud and on‑premise projects, ensuring alignment with industry best practices.
Requirements
- 3+ years of hands‑on experience in network security engineering, preferably in a VAR or managed services environment.
- Strong knowledge of Cisco networking, firewall platforms (e.g., Palo Alto, Fortinet), VPN technologies, and IDS/IPS solutions.
- Proficiency in Python scripting for automation and security tooling.
- Experience with security frameworks and standards such as NIST, ISO 27001, or PCI DSS.
- Relevant certifications (e.g., CCNA/CCNP Security, CISSP, GSEC) are a plus.
